Self-Publishing a Book in German, with Orna Ross and Skye MacKinnon
Q: How has AI translation changed your approach since the second edition?
AI translation is a major shift; it lowers costs but requires careful editing and clear labeling that a book has AI involvement; the second edition includes extensive guidance on AI translations, the legal labeling requirements, and the importance of human editors to ensure quality and market fit.
Self-Publishing a Book in German, with Orna Ross and Skye MacKinnon
Q: Could you address the distribution piece and how Tolino and fixed pricing interact with getting German books into stores?
In Germany, there is a fixed pricing law that standardizes pricing across stores, which affected distributor discounts and caused retailers to block certain channels; Tolino emerged as a self-publishing ecosystem that allows direct publishing and coordinated promotions across many bookstores, making it easier to get into German stores and into readers' hands.
Self-Publishing a Book in German, with Orna Ross and Skye MacKinnon
Q: What is the single biggest mistake you see English language authors making when translating into German?
Not properly researching and respecting the German market, especially around pricing, titles, and metadata, and underestimating the need for human translation and localization rather than relying solely on AI for core elements like blurb and title.

Inspirational Indie Author Interview #212: Annabel Youens on Midlife Reinvention and Creative Independence
Q: How are you handling marketing right now, and what kind of audience do you want to attract?
She explains a two-pronged funnel: a Substack for readers interested in midlife and creative nonfiction, and BookTok as a growing community where she builds engagement by sharing humor, reviews, and book-related content, while tracking links and using UTM parameters to measure effectiveness.

Frequently Asked Questions About Self-Publishing with ALLi

What is Self-Publishing with ALLi about and what kind of topics does it cover?

A practical guide for indie authors, with a steady stream of episodes on self-publishing strategy, book design, marketing, distribution, and industry news. The show frequently features practitioners and educators who share actionable tips—ranging from design choices and branding to reader engagement, pricing, and leveraging alliances within the indie publishing ecosystem. A notable strength is the mix of in-depth interviews, live Q&As, and timely industry updates that help listeners navigate platform changes, AI impacts, and evolving distribution channels.
